If you want a roadster I would definately consider the boxster as an option. I was in the same place you are a year ago and I chose the boxster over a Miata, TT, S2000, and whatever else. I bought my car with 20k miles on it and now have 34k without any problems at all. The guy who owned the car before me took great care of it as it had a car cover on even in his heated garage. I've done the maintanance myself so it only cost me $200 or so for the 30k service and the car runs awesome. The problem with the ones that have blown motors is that people abuse them, they try to get Carerra performance out of it and it's just not gonna go that fast. I woulde definately take this car over the other roadsters, as long as you find one that has been properly taken care of. The boxster is not the same product Porsche had out 10 years ago which was prone to problems, this is a very modern car that is reliable.
